Our detailed Chief Human Resources Officer Salary Guide (refer to page 27 for figures) examines multiple factors impacting compensation in Sacramento:
Industry Sector: A company’s industry strongly affects Chief Human Resources Officer salaries in Sacramento. Leading sectors like technology, healthcare, and finance usually provide higher wages, reflecting their intricate demands and strategic needs.
Company Size and International Reach: Typically, salaries increase with a company’s breadth and international scale, highlighting the enhanced responsibilities and challenges involved in these roles. When analyzing Chief Human Resources Officer by company size Sacramento, a clear link between organizational scale and pay levels is evident.
Experience and Expertise: The Chief HR Officer salary also relies on experience and special skills. Traits like strategic guidance, adeptness in change management, and a history of talent nurturing and organizational improvement are highly valued.

Calculating Average Salaries for Chief Human Resources Officers in Sacramento
For precise salary calculations for a Chief Human Resources Officer in Sacramento, first refer to the average Chief Human Resources Officer salary for California. These particulars are detailed on page 27 of our Salary Guide. After acquiring the state average, reduce this figure by 5% to find a competitive salary within the Sacramento market.
For instance, if the salary range for a Chief Human Resources Officer in California is $220,000, lowering this number by 5% provides a Sacramento-specific average of $209,000. In a small Sacramento business, Chief Human Resources Officer salaries generally vary from $160,000 to $270,000 annually.
